nacos连不上数据库,nacos 数据库 (解决方法与步骤)
下面内容仅为某些场景参考,为稳妥起见请先联系上面的专业技术工程师,具体环境具体分析。
2023-09-18 20:10 575
当Nacos运行一段时间后,数据库连接失败可能有以下几种原因:
1. 数据库服务崩溃或重启:在Nacos运行时,如果数据库服务发生崩溃或重启,会导致数据库连接失败。此时,需要检查数据库服务的状态,并确保它正常运行。
2. 数据库连接池耗尽:如果Nacos的数据库连接池中的连接数耗尽,新的数据库连接请求就会失败。这可能是由于配置不合理、数据库连接泄露、高负载等原因导致的。解决办法是增加数据库连接池的大小或者优化数据库连接的使用方式。
3. 数据库连接超时:当Nacos与数据库的连接超过数据库的超时设置时,会导致数据库连接失败。通常,数据库连接的超时时间可以通过相关配置进行调整。
4. 数据库账号密码错误:在Nacos运行一段时间后,数据库账号和密码可能发生变化,如果更新不及时,就会导致数据库连接失败。确保Nacos的数据库账号和密码与数据库一致。
5. 网络问题:数据库连接失败还可能是由于网络问题造成的,比如网络延迟、防火墙设置等。在此情况下,可以通过检查网络连接是否正常,或者联系网络管理员进行解决。
如果以上方法都无法解决问题,可以通过查看Nacos的日志文件获取更详细的错误信息,并根据日志中的提示进行排查和修复。